Attached file testcase
Reduced testcase.
Renders differently in Moz and IE. Not sure which one is right, though.
Removing "top: 0pt;" from the third div or removing the <br> makes it render
the same.
This <br> is what's left in my testcase of the 17 (!) <br>'s that are in the
original page and that do not change anything in IE but break things in
Mozilla.
If the site should get evangelized (that sounds a bit ironic with a christian
site as this one...) they should simply remove those abundant linebreaks and
everything should be well.
